The SCCC conference is a forum for the presentation of recent original work and it is an opportunity for students and researchers to extend their research network. The conference is sponsored by IEEE Computer Society Chile Chapter and the Chilean Computer Science Society. The conference covers the broad field of computer science and informatics, considering the following topics of interest (but not limited to): Algorithms, Artificial intelligence, Bioinformatics, Business process mining, Business process models, Collaborative systems, Computer games, Computer graphics, Computer networks, Computer vision, Databases, Distributed and parallel systems, Ethics of AI, Human-computer interaction, Information retrieval, Applied computing (Operations Research, Arts and Humanities), Hardware, Model-driven engineering, Multi-agent systems, Multimedia, Natural language processing, Numerical methods, Operating systems, Programming languages, Theory of computer science, Security and cryptography, Simulation, Software engineering, Text and data mining, Ubiquitous and Mobile Computing, Web technologies, Mathematics of computing. Curso Machine Learning Aplicado

Virtual: https://events.vtools.ieee.org/m/333764

La rama estudiantil de la UTN.BA junto con MUTT.DATA se complace a presentar el siiguiente curso destinado a dar una introducción a temas de Machine Learning (ML) a cargo de Pablo Lorenzatto CTO de Mutt Data. Cantidad de clases: 2 Fechas: 28 y 30 de Noviembre Modalidad: 100% remota. Duracion: Cada clase consistirá en 1 hora sincrónica Speaker(s): Pablo Lorenzatto, Agenda: Clase 1: Introducción a ML Teoria: - ¿Qué es Machine Learning? - Tipos de algoritmos: supervisados (clasificación y regresión), no supervisados (clustering, reducción de dimensionalidad) y semi-supervisados. - ¿Qué es deep learning? Transfer learning. - ¿Qué son las métricas de ML? Evaluación básica de modelos. Práctica: Demostraciones de modelos de ML usando Scikit Learn. Clase 2: ML productivo Teoria: - Lifecycle de modelos productivos de ML: MLOps - Intro a reglas de ML de Google - Predicciones Batch y Online - Arquitecturas Realtime - Mención de temas varios: Data Quality, Airflow, Model Tracking, Feature stores Virtual: https://events.vtools.ieee.org/m/333764

XVII IEEE Latin-American Summer School on Computational Intelligence (EVIC) December 12-14, 2022 Universidad Tecnológica Metropolitana, Chile Casa Central, Dieciocho 161, Santiago (Metro Los Héroes), Chile Poster Competition - 1st call for abstract deadline: November 11th, 2022 (http://evic2022.utem.cl/) ================================================================ The XVII Summer School on Computational Intelligence will take place in Universidad Tecnológica Metropolitana, Santiago. It is jointly organized by the Chilean Chapter of the IEEE Computational Intelligence Society and the Faculty of Engineering, Universidad Tecnológica Metropolitana. The summer schools aim to promote Computational Intelligence, bringing together areas such as Intelligent Control Systems, Astroinformatics, Biomedical Engineering, Bio-Informatics, Robotics, Computer Vision, Computational Neuroscience, Science Data, Big Data, among others, in order to disseminate the basic knowledge and the latest research advances to students, professors and professionals from Chile and other Latin American countries. During the Summer School, a Student Poster Competition on Computational Intelligence will be held. ==== Confirmed speakers ==== - Gary Yen, Regents Professor with the School of Electrical and Computer Engineering from Oklahoma State University (United States).
